Eleanor Morgan Bsc (hons), CPCAB Diploma Therapeutic Counselling, MBACP (Registered)
Born and raised in Wales, I settled in Hampshire in 2007 after a period of living abroad.
I began my own personal therapy at the same time, having faced bouts of depression and anxiety throughout my life.
Experiencing the benefits for myself, in 2009 I chose to give up my career in international marketing to re-train as a counsellor.
I seek to develop meaningful connection within a safe, confidential space. Everyone deserves to explore what is really important to them and I work in a way that enables you to do just that.
My approach is a holistic one, which means that I will focus on you in your entirety - as the mind, body and spirit are fundamentally interconnected.
I am a member of the British Association of Counsellors and Psychotherapists. I am always studying and looking to improve my skills through professional development. I have a particular interest in feminist theory, depth and transpersonal psychology, archetypal psychology, systemic therapy and trans-generational trauma.
I have had the privilege of working with a broad spectrum of clients, including a number of years working with young adults in higher education.
In 2022 I relocated to Bali, Indonesia, where I am enjoying immersing myself in the culture and learning a different way of life.
I love what I do and am proud to say that my clients are my greatest teachers.
